My biggest issue with youtube reviewers are the people who complain about them. If someone is typically overly positive, they're a "suck up" or a "shill". If someone gives you cold, hard facts they're "abrasive" and "polarizing". Let the guys run their channels how they want. What do I care if a guy gets free samples from the toy company? Because that basically makes him an employee and he's not unbiased? So what? The GI Joe commercials I saw on TV when I was a kid weren't unbiased either. They cast the toys in the best possible light to make them attractive to the buyers. I (my mom) still bought what I wanted (if I was a good boy or if it was my birthday) and if I didn't want it I passed. As an adult, toys get advertised in different ways, but I'm ultimately the one making the calls.

Damaizing, Robo, Shartimus, Anthony Customs, erivera, and a couple of others are usually my go-tos. They all have their own style, but one thing they have in common is smooth camera work, easy to see, detailed looks at various aspects of the figure, good comparisons, (generally) not wasting time while they try to figure out technical issues on camera. The quality of the presentation is often more important to me vs what they say about it, heck, sometimes I watch with the sound off. I mostly know who's getting their stuff from the company, I know who the borderline apologists are, if they make good videos, it's all OK. I just want to see what I'm thinking about buying. And if I still have questions one way or another after watching one of those guys, then I go watch another.

I think a lot of toy reviewers review stuff they like to begin with, so there’s often going to be more positive reviews than negative ones. There are some that come across as apologetic about the product or won’t even talk about the price and those reviews strike me more as showcases than actual reviews. They have some value, just know what you’re getting into. I’m mostly of the mind that if it’s well lit and professionally edited then it’s probably good enough for what I need from it. Anyone who only accepts product in exchange for a positive review is indeed a shill, but that’s hard to prove. A bunch of people get free stuff from the prominent companies so we would likely know if any of those companies made such demands. I know Anthony said Hiya Toys approached him about such an arrangement that he turned down, so I guess that’s one company to be wary of. Bonus points to anyone who demonstrates parts swapping on camera since some figures can be a pain and I like to see that demonstrated. I also like fresh out of the box reviews, no heating of joints or anything, to get the most accurate sense of what the figure will be like for me. Though actual unboxings I find worthless and a waste of time.
